Aracılığıyla paylaş


WebClient.GetWebResponse Yöntem

Tanım

Belirtilen WebRequestiçin değerini WebResponse döndürür.

Aşırı Yüklemeler

GetWebResponse(WebRequest)

Belirtilen WebRequestiçin değerini WebResponse döndürür.

GetWebResponse(WebRequest, IAsyncResult)

WebResponse Belirtilen WebRequest öğesini kullanarak belirtilen için değerini IAsyncResultdöndürür.

GetWebResponse(WebRequest)

Kaynak:
WebClient.cs
Kaynak:
WebClient.cs
Kaynak:
WebClient.cs

Belirtilen WebRequestiçin değerini WebResponse döndürür.

protected:
 virtual System::Net::WebResponse ^ GetWebResponse(System::Net::WebRequest ^ request);
protected virtual System.Net.WebResponse GetWebResponse (System.Net.WebRequest request);
abstract member GetWebResponse : System.Net.WebRequest -> System.Net.WebResponse
override this.GetWebResponse : System.Net.WebRequest -> System.Net.WebResponse
Protected Overridable Function GetWebResponse (request As WebRequest) As WebResponse

Parametreler

request
WebRequest

WebRequest Yanıtı almak için kullanılan.

Döndürülenler

WebResponse Belirtilen WebRequestiçin yanıtı içeren bir .

Örnekler

Aşağıdaki kod örneği, bu yöntemin uygulamasından WebClienttüretilen bir sınıf tarafından özelleştirilebilen bir uygulamasını gösterir.

virtual WebResponse^ GetWebResponse( WebRequest^ request ) override
{
   WebResponse^ response = WebClient::GetWebResponse( request );

   // Perform any custom actions with the response ...
   return response;
}
protected override WebResponse GetWebResponse (WebRequest request)
{
    WebResponse response = base.GetWebResponse (request);
    // Perform any custom actions with the response ...
    return response;
}

Açıklamalar

Bu yöntem tarafından döndürülen nesne, belirtilen WebRequest nesnede GetResponse yöntemi çağrılarak elde edilir.

Bu yöntem yalnızca 'den WebClientdevralan sınıflar tarafından çağrılabilir. Devralanlara temel alınan WebResponse nesneye erişim vermek için sağlanır.

Şunlara uygulanır

GetWebResponse(WebRequest, IAsyncResult)

Kaynak:
WebClient.cs
Kaynak:
WebClient.cs
Kaynak:
WebClient.cs

WebResponse Belirtilen WebRequest öğesini kullanarak belirtilen için değerini IAsyncResultdöndürür.

protected:
 virtual System::Net::WebResponse ^ GetWebResponse(System::Net::WebRequest ^ request, IAsyncResult ^ result);
protected virtual System.Net.WebResponse GetWebResponse (System.Net.WebRequest request, IAsyncResult result);
abstract member GetWebResponse : System.Net.WebRequest * IAsyncResult -> System.Net.WebResponse
override this.GetWebResponse : System.Net.WebRequest * IAsyncResult -> System.Net.WebResponse
Protected Overridable Function GetWebResponse (request As WebRequest, result As IAsyncResult) As WebResponse

Parametreler

request
WebRequest

WebRequest Yanıtı almak için kullanılan.

result
IAsyncResult

öğesine IAsyncResult yapılan önceki bir çağrıdan BeginGetResponse(AsyncCallback, Object) alınan nesne.

Döndürülenler

WebResponse Belirtilen WebRequestiçin yanıtı içeren bir .

Örnekler

Aşağıdaki kod örneği, bu yöntemin uygulamasından WebClienttüretilen bir sınıf tarafından özelleştirilebilen bir uygulamasını gösterir.

virtual WebResponse^ GetWebResponse( WebRequest^ request, IAsyncResult^ result ) override
{
   WebResponse^ response = WebClient::GetWebResponse( request, result );

   // Perform any custom actions with the response ...
   return response;
}
protected override WebResponse GetWebResponse (WebRequest request, IAsyncResult result)
{
    WebResponse response = base.GetWebResponse (request, result);
    // Perform any custom actions with the response ...
    return response;
}

Açıklamalar

Bu yöntem tarafından döndürülen nesne, belirtilen WebRequest nesnede EndGetResponse yöntemi çağrılarak elde edilir.

Bu yöntem yalnızca 'den WebClientdevralan sınıflar tarafından çağrılabilir. Devralanlara temel alınan WebResponse nesneye erişim vermek için sağlanır.

Şunlara uygulanır